Decoding the MLB The Show Release Cadence
Understanding the release schedule for MLB The Show requires distinguishing between the annual game launch and the ongoing content updates. Sony Interactive Entertainment and San Diego Studio, the developers behind the franchise, follow a predictable pattern for major releases, while smaller content drops are less rigidly scheduled.
Annual Game Launch
The highly anticipated annual MLB The Show game typically hits shelves in late March or early April, coinciding with the commencement of the MLB season. This launch includes significant updates to gameplay, rosters, graphics, and game modes. Content Updates and Programs
Beyond the annual game, MLB The Show features a dynamic stream of content updates designed to keep players engaged throughout the baseball season. These updates often introduce new programs, Moments, player cards, and gameplay tweaks. These “episodes” or program drops are much more frequent than the annual release. You can generally expect a major content drop every 1-2 weeks during the season.

FAQ 3: What Kind of Content is Included in These Updates?
Content updates can include a variety of features:
- New Programs: These are sets of challenges and missions that reward players with valuable player cards and other items.
- Moments: Recreate historical baseball moments or face unique challenges.
- Player Card Updates: Ratings for current MLB players are updated regularly based on real-world performance.
- Gameplay Tweaks: San Diego Studio constantly refines the gameplay based on community feedback.
- Cosmetic Items: Unlock new uniforms, equipment, and stadium customization options.

FAQ 6: What is Diamond Dynasty and How Does it Relate to Content Updates?
Diamond Dynasty is MLB The Show’s card-collecting mode. It allows players to build their dream team using player cards earned through gameplay or purchased with in-game currency. Content updates often introduce new Diamond Dynasty programs and cards, making it a central part of the overall MLB The Show experience.

FAQ 12: How Does the MLB Season Impact Content Updates in The Show?
The MLB season heavily influences the content updates in The Show. Updates often reflect real-world events, such as player performances, milestones, and special events like the All-Star Game and the playoffs. These events often trigger special programs within the game.
